Analysis
Syria recorded -35.62 % change on previous year for secondary education, general pupils, annual growth rate in 2013. That is the lowest value across all 42 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 2,046.5% on the previous year and down 140.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, secondary education, general pupils, annual growth rate in Syria peaked at 87.61 % change on previous year in 2003 and was at its lowest, -35.62 % change on previous year, in 2013.
That places Syria 202nd out of 202 countries with data for 2013,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Secondary education, general pupils.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Secondary education, general pupils Stat Bulk Data Download Service, UN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
